Buying Guide: Walk-Behind Concrete Floor Cleaners

  • Cleaning width and throughput: Wider paths speed up large-area cleaning. Look for 22″ paths and squeegee widths near 31″ for efficient one-pass water recovery.
  • Power and portability: Cordless options reduce trip hazards from cords. If you have long aisles, a self-propelled model can cut operator fatigue and boost productivity.
  • Tank capacity and runtime: Larger solution and recovery tanks extend cleaning cycles between refills. Consider runtime relative to shift length and charging times.
  • Surface compatibility: Concrete floors vary in porosity and sealant. Multi-surface scrubbers support tile, epoxy, and sealed hard floors; if you primarily clean concrete, ensure effective removal of grime and stains.
  • Maintenance considerations: Look for units with rugged housings and easily replaceable brushes, pads, and seals. Cordless units require battery care and replacement cycles.
  • Chemical use: For stains or oil residues, pair scrubbers with appropriate cleaners. Waterless cleaners can be useful for maintenance over large outdoor concrete areas.

FAQ

  1. What is the best walk-behind floor scrubber for concrete?
    Answer: The best choice depends on space. For large open areas, a self-propelled or cordless 22″ model with a wide squeegee is often most productive, while smaller rooms may benefit from a compact 15″ model.
  2. How long do cordless walk-behind scrubbers run on a single charge?
    Answer: Run time varies by battery capacity and cleaning intensity; many units offer 2–4 hours of operation per charge with typical workloads.
  3. Is a larger water tank important for concrete cleaning?
    Answer: Yes, larger solution and recovery tanks reduce refill frequency, especially in warehouses and schools with long corridors.
  4. Can I use a waterless cleaner on concrete floors?
    Answer: Waterless powders like EXIMO are best for oil stains and surface-cleaning tasks; for heavy dirt, you’ll still need a scrubber with a water-based cleaning step.
  5. Should I choose corded or cordless for a large facility?
    Answer: Cordless reduces cord management concerns and trip hazards. For extremely large facilities, a self-propelled, high-throughput model can maximize efficiency.
